- To PLAY:
- It's you against the Palm. There are 10 rounds in the game;
- each round consisting of one turn for each player. Players add the score that they
- attain on each round and the player with the highest score at the end is the winner.
- The player to go first is determined randomly by the Palm before the game starts.
- The turn: You may roll the dice as many times as you wish. The total on your first
- roll becomes the point to AVOID. If you roll that score again before passing, you get
- no points scored for that round. On the other hand, if the total on your dice is
- anything other than the point to avoid, you add the total of the dice to your score
- for that round.
- After each successful roll, you can stop and decide whether to roll again, or keep
- the points already attained, and pass the dice.
- Don't get too greedy. That's why it's called "Pig." But you must be enough of a pig
- to win. The palm plays a fairly good game of Pig. It does NOT cheat.
- Statistics are kept on number of games and number of wins.

- HISTORY:
- I adapted this from the game called "Not One", which I first saw in the book
- "More BASIC Computer Games" by David H. Ahl published in 1980. It was evidently called
- "Pig" in its earlier incarnations.
